What is SkyAtlas?

Transition to a powerful cloud infrastructure tailored for enterprises to boost efficiency and reduce expenses while delivering critical IT services! Our platform harnesses the capabilities of OpenStack technology, which underpins some of the largest IT infrastructures globally, including renowned organizations like NASA, HP, Rackspace, and eBay. We take pride in being the pioneering provider of OpenStack public cloud services in the MENA region. Our expert technical support is available 24/7, seamlessly integrated with the SkyAtlas cloud infrastructure. Our committed cloud engineers are ready to assist you via email, phone, or live chat whenever you require assistance. The SkyAtlas API enables you to manage your cloud resources easily and programmatically, facilitating the automation of routine tasks through a user-friendly RESTful interface. Additionally, our system continuously monitors your servers' resource requirements in real-time, automatically adjusting processor and memory allocations as necessary, without any manual intervention, to ensure peak performance consistently. What is MicroStack?

Effortlessly establish and manage OpenStack on a Linux system with MicroStack, which is specifically tailored for developers and ideal for applications in edge computing, Internet of Things, and various hardware appliances. MicroStack delivers a comprehensive OpenStack experience wrapped into a single snap package, enabling a multi-node deployment that can run straight from your workstation. Although its main target audience consists of developers, it is also a fantastic option for environments at the edge, IoT configurations, and appliance use. Simply download MicroStack from the Snap Store, and within a very short time, you can initiate your OpenStack environment. In just a few minutes, your fully operational OpenStack system will be ready for use. It operates securely on laptops by utilizing innovative isolation methods to ensure safety. This implementation includes pure upstream OpenStack components such as Keystone, Nova, Neutron, Glance, and Cinder, providing all the exciting features you'd want in a compact, standard OpenStack configuration. You can seamlessly incorporate MicroStack into your CI/CD workflows, which allows you to concentrate on your projects without facing unnecessary hurdles. It’s important to note that for optimal performance, MicroStack requires at least 8 GB of RAM and a multi-core processor.
